Directions

  1. Combine 1 1/2 cup water, cracked wheat, and salt in a saucepan. Bring to a boil; reduce heat to medium low. Cook, stirring occasionally, until water is absorbed, about 15 minutes. Remove from heat.
  2. Mix 1/3 cup water, sugar, and yeast together in a large bowl. Let stand until yeast forms a creamy foam, about 5 minutes.
  3. Stir buttermilk, honey, molasses, 1/4 cup butter, wheat germ, flax seed, and bran into the cracked wheat until blended. Mix in whole wheat flour.
  4. Mix cracked wheat mixture into the yeast mixture using a spoon or electric mixer. Add all-purpose flour 1 cup at a time, mixing until dough is smooth and elastic.
  5. Place dough in a large greased bowl, cover, and let rise until doubled in size, about 1 hour.
  6. Punch down dough to release air. Divide dough into 2 equal pieces. Roll out pieces into rectangles to release any air bubbles. Roll up, pinching seams tightly and tucking in sides as you go.
  7. Grease two 9x5-inch loaf pans. Place rolls seam side-down in the pans; press down to flatten. Tuck in all sides gently with the top of a finger. Cover and let rise in a warm place until dough rises 1 inch above the rim of the pans, about 45 minutes.
  8.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
  9. Bake loaves until golden brown and the bottoms sound hollow when tapped, about 35 minutes. Brush with 2 tablespoons melted butter and turn out onto wire racks to cool. Allow to cool completely before slicing.
